The next generation of Ford’s EcoBoost turbocharged, direct-injection gasoline engines will introduce cooled EGR (exhaust gas recirculation), enabling higher compression ratios, according to Ford executives speaking at the SAE 2010 World Congress in Detroit. Butanol (C 4 H 10 O), a four-carbon alcohol in widespread use as an industrial solvent, has an energy content closer to gasoline than ethanol’s. It is non-corrosive, can be distributed through existing pipelines, and can be—but does not have to be—blended with fossil fuels.

Among the findings were: GHG emissions of gasoline ICEVs and HEVs are generally the same across provinces, since the emissions occur mainly during vehicle operation. On a national average, EVs and CNGVs can reduce fuel-cycle GHG emissions per kilometer traveled by 20% and 6%, relative to ICEVs. Credit: ACS, Huo et al. Click to enlarge.
